- 'CURSMAN (Cursor Manipulations) will show you:
-
- 'How to get real cursor positions (positions of the entire screen)
- 'How to clip a cursor into a part of the screen
- 'How to hide and restore cursor (this won't disable it just hide it)
- 'How to move the cursor to specific location on the screen

- 'NOTES:
- '
- ' 1- The routine to hide the cursor don't disable it, the cursor still
- ' active but hidden.
- '
- ' To enables or disables mouse and keyboard input to the specified window
- ' or control use this API call on one line.
-
- ' Declare Function EnableWindow Lib "User"
- ' (ByVal hWnd As Integer, ByVal aBOOL As Integer) As Integer
-
- ' When input is disable, input such as mouse clicks and key presses
- ' are ignored by the window. When input is enabled, all input is processed.
-
- ' 2- If you clip the cursor, you won't be able to move it out of the form, but
- ' if you drag the form you will see that the clipped area disapeared. It's
- ' because, by moving the frame windows reseted the clipped area. To prevent
- ' this, just set the top of the clipping area for the form to disallow cursor
- ' from reaching it.
-
- ' 3- If you exit the program without unclipping, the cursor will be restricted
- ' to the clipped area. Just call the unclip routines in you program when you
- ' you exit them.

- 'Cursor Types for Records
- Type POINTAPI
- x As Integer
- Y As Integer
- End Type
-
- Type RECT
- Left As Integer
- Top As Integer
- Right As Integer
- Bottom As Integer
- End Type
-
- 'Cursor Record for API calls
- Global Pos As POINTAPI
- Global TPos As POINTAPI
- Global ClipWin As RECT
-
- 'Cursor constants
- Global Const C_HIDE = 0
- Global Const C_SHOW = -1
- Global C_State As Integer 'State of the cursor - hidden of not
-
- 'API declaration for cursor manipulations
- Declare Sub GetCursorPos Lib "User" (lpPoint As POINTAPI)
- Declare Function SetCursorPos Lib "User" (ByVal x%, ByVal Y%) As Integer
- Declare Function ShowCursor Lib "User" (ByVal State%) As Integer
- Declare Sub ClipCursor Lib "User" (lpRect As Any)
